King,
Warrior, Magician, Lover
: Rediscovering the Archetypes of the Mature Masculine
by Robert L. Moore, Douglas Gillette.
Discusses how mature masculine energy is different from the overwhelmingly
common, immature forms. We have a shortage of mature, centered,
conscious, powerful, caring, creative male energy in our culture --
and an abundance of immature, unbalanced, abusive, demanding, demeaning,
shortsighted energy, resulting in the crisis in male identity that we
face today. This book is about our accessing the mature masculine
energies in our lives.

Shambhala:
The Sacred Path of the Warrior
, by Chögyam Trungpa
"In this practical guide to enlightened living, Chögyam Trungpa
offers an inspiring vision for our time, based on the figure of the
sacred warrior... He acquired a sense of personal freedom and power--not
through violence or aggression, but through gentleness, courage, and
self-knowledge. The Japanese samurai, the warrior-kings of Tibet,
the knights of medieval Europe, and the warriors of the Native American
tribes are a few examples of this universal tradition of wisdom...
Interpreting the warrior's journey in modern terms, Trungpa discusses
such skills as synchronizing mind and body, overcoming habitual behaviors,
relaxing within discipline, facing the world with openness and fearlessness,
and finding the sacred dimension of everyday life. Above all,
Trungpa shows that in discovering the basic goodness of human life,
the warrior learns to radiate that goodness out into the world for
the peace and sanity of others." [from the back cover]

Self-Nurture:
Learning to Care for Yourself as Effectively as You Care for Everyone
Else
, by Alice Domar, Ph.D., director of Harvard Medical School's Mind/Body
Center for Women's Health.
In
"Self-Nurture," Domar presents a year-long program--one
that she developed for all women so that they can learn to take care
of themselves while juggling work and family demands. She writes, "'Self-Nurture'
is a yearlong stress manager for women. It offers specific guidance
for handling the stresses that plague you, but the goal of every exercise
and method is self-nurturance. It is a practical book, mapping greater
awareness and self-care from one season to the next. I offer this
book as a balm for today's overextended, underappreciated, self-esteem-challenged
women. While so many of us present smart, tough fronts to the world,
we still suffer from grave insecurities and unfulfilled dreams. Psychiatrist
Alexander Lowen once commented that we can only rise up if we allow
ourselves to let down, and women who self-nurture will rise up with
renewed strength and confidence."
It should be noted that while Domar's book was written specifically
with women in mind, she's heard from dozens of men--some of them at
her book signings--who've said
"Self-Nurture" was also invaluable to them as they seek
to find balance in life.
